- Marshall Plan
- https://www.britannica.com/event/Marshall-Plan
- - Formally called the “European Recovery Program”
- - (1948-1951)
- - Plan to rehabilitate economy of Europe
- - George C. Marshall
- - Self-help program
- - Financed by United States
- - It was offered to virtually all European countries
- - Communistic and Eastern countries withdrew from participation
- - Countries in plan:
- o Austria, Belgium, Denmark, France, Greece, Iceland, Ireland, Italy, Luxembourg, the Netherlands, Norway, Portugal, Sweden, Switzerland, Turkey, the United Kingdom, and western Germany.
- - Four-year plan
- - Financial aid for
- o Trade
- o Agriculture
- o Industrialization
- - Financed 13 billion dollars from U.S over the period or 4 years
